G-Town Police get G-Ticketed!
Monday, 21 July 2008
Image

Lieutenant Robert Swanigan of the Georgetown Police Department received training on the G-Ticket system today. He will now handle the GPD Tickets directly and relay the ticket information to the correct officers.

Currently the G-Ticket system will only accept Traffic Enforcement related issues. Police Chief Greg Reeves and the Lieutenant both agreed that there should remain total anonymity when it comes to Tip-a-Cop and other related reporting tools found on their website.

Garbage Collection Schedule: 4th of July
Wednesday, 02 July 2008

CITY OF GEORGETOWN
GARBAGE COLLECTION SCHEDULE 2008

Fourth of July

Image
The City of Georgetown Public Works Department will be closed Friday, July 4, 2008.  If your regular scheduled pick up is Friday, July 4, 2008, it will be picked up Monday, July 7, 2008.

G-Ticket Update
Thursday, 26 June 2008

G-Ticket BETA is the City of Georgetown's NEW! System to track and to respond to community complaints, requests and inquiries!

What does BETA mean?Image
  • Still under development or real-time development
  • Many features on the to-do list
  • Patience from staff and citizens
  • Think of it like a pilot for a TV Show, a trial run

We are please to announce that we have had several submissions into our G-Ticket system over the past week! Most of the tickets have fallen to the Public Works Department, which is currently Online. Other tickets have fallen to county departments or to other city departments that are not currently trained on the G-Ticket System. Please do not let this discourage you from submitting your G-Ticket. We take the responsibility to forward your request to the correct department and update your ticket until these other departments are brought online.
